General annotation (Comments)

Function

Catalyzes the attachment of tyrosine to tRNA(Tyr) in a two-step reaction: tyrosine is first activated by ATP to form Tyr-AMP and then transferred to the acceptor end of tRNA(Tyr) By similarity.

Catalytic activity

ATP + L-tyrosine + tRNA(Tyr) = AMP + diphosphate + L-tyrosyl-tRNA(Tyr).

Subcellular location

Cytoplasm By similarity.

Sequence similarities

Belongs to the class-I aminoacyl-tRNA synthetase family.

Contains 1 tRNA-binding domain.
